The calculator obtains the greatest common divisor of the numerator and denominator, then divides both terms by that number.
A fraction is in simplest form when its numerator and denominator have no common divisor greater than one. For 24/36, the GCD is 12, so dividing both terms gives 2/3.
For example, 18/24 becomes 3/4 after dividing the numerator and denominator by 6.
